1 Samuel 27:4

Bible in Basic English

4 And Saul, hearing that David had gone to Gath, went after him no longer.
Original Language Text
hebrew
וַ/יֻּגַּ֣ד לְ/שָׁא֔וּל כִּֽי בָרַ֥ח דָּוִ֖ד גַּ֑ת וְ/לֹֽא יוסף יָסַ֥ף ע֖וֹד לְ/בַקְשֽׁ/וֹ
English Translation
And it was reported to Saul that David had fled to Gath, and he did not seek him anymore.
